Rewrite the second sentence: The bus leaves in 5 minutes and we still are far away from the station. We'll definitely miss it.
We ARE BOUND to miss it.
Correct the mistake: The economy of the country bound to collapse by the end of the year.
The economy of the country IS bound to collapse...
Fill in the gaps: ____ she _________ to get this job with her bad English? I doubt that.
Is ... likely
Correct the mistake: It is strongly unlikely that she will win the first prize.
It is HIGHLY unlikely...
Rewrite the sentence: When are you expecting the baby?
When IS the baby DUE ?
Correct the mistake: He has studied so hard the whole term, he is bounded to pass the exam.
... he is BOUND to pass the exam...
Rewrite the sentence: The odds are that with this addition to the team we will to qualify to the semi-final.
With this addition to the team we ARE LIKELY to qualify to the semi-final.
Correct the mistake: They are due to win the final tomorrow.
They are BOUND / LIKELY to win...
Fill in the gap: The report ______ by Monday. Otherwise you will be fired.
is due
Correct the mistake: When the train is due?
When IS the train due?
Fill in the gap: They've been way better than the others all way through. They ___________ to win the competition.
are bound to
Correct the mistake: It's a dead place. You're likely to find anything interesting there.
You're UNlikely to find ...
Fill in the gaps: When _ the train to London __ ?
is ... due
